Re. Marble and bronze
Nowhere near as high-profile but a night out everyone can enjoy is at La Note Blue or Jimmy'z. Both have quality music playing but be sure to dress smart for both of them because they have notoriously picky doormen.

A lovely and free beach
There was clean water and sand at Larvotto Beach and we started the day off there more or less every morning before deciding what to do. Never too packed but not too desolate either. Don't have to pay a cracker to get onto it either.
